Laetitia used to make two “regular” bottling of Pinot Noir – one, produced from purchased juice, was strictly for restaurants, the other, made from estate fruit, for retail. Two years ago they decided to drop the restaurant brand and stick with the estate bottling. A wise decision, as the estate Pinot was far superior. And they lowered the price on this wine, another wise decision. I carry over 75 pinots – this is my top seller. The quality-value ratio is high on the Richter scale. Talley Vineyards established Arroyo Grande as a legitimate source for great Pinot Noirs – Laetitia is riding on their coattails.
